Controller placement with critical switch aware in software-defined network (CPCSA)

被引:0
|
作者
Yusuf N.M. [1 ,2 ]
Bakar K.A. [1 ]
Isyaku B. [1 ,3 ]
Abdelmaboud A. [4 ]
Nagmeldin W. [5 ]
机构
[1] Department of Computer Science, Faculty of Computing, Universiti Teknologi Malaysia, Johor, Johor Bahru
[2] Department of Mathematical Science, Faculty of Sciences, Abubakar Tafawa Balewa University, Bauchi
[3] Department of Computer Science, Faculty of Computing and Information Technology, Sule Lamido University, Kafin Hausa, Jigawa State
[4] Department of Information Systems, King Khalid University, Abha
[5] Department of Information Systems, College of Computer Engineering and Sciences, Prince Sattam bin Abdulaziz University, Al-Kharj
关键词
Controller overhead; Controller placement; Network partition; SDN; Switch role;
D O I
10.7717/PEERJ-CS.1698
中图分类号
学科分类号
摘要
Software-defined networking (SDN) is a networking architecture with improved efficiency achieved by moving networking decisions from the data plane to provide them critically at the control plane. In a traditional SDN, typically, a single controller is used. However, the complexity of modern networks due to their size and high traffic volume with varied quality of service requirements have introduced high control message communications overhead on the controller. Similarly, the solution found using multiple distributed controllers brings forth the ‘controller placement problem’ (CPP). Incorporating switch roles in the CPP modelling during network partitioning for controller placement has not been adequately considered by any existing CPP techniques. This article proposes the controller placement algorithm with network partition based on critical switch awareness (CPCSA). CPCSA identifies critical switch in the software defined wide area network (SDWAN) and then partition the network based on the criticality. Subsequently, a controller is assigned to each partition to improve control messages communication overhead, loss, throughput, and flow setup delay. The CPSCSA experimented with real network topologies obtained from the Internet Topology Zoo. Results show that CPCSA has achieved an aggregate reduction in the controller’s overhead by 73%, loss by 51%, and latency by 16% while improving throughput by 16% compared to the benchmark algorithms. © Copyright 2023 Muhammed Yusuf et al.
引用
收藏
相关论文
共 50 条
  • [31] A k-Cover Model for Reliability-Aware Controller Placement in Software-Defined Networks
    Schutz, Gabriela
    COMPUTATIONAL SCIENCE - ICCS 2019, PT I, 2019, 11536 : 604 - 613
  • [32] Capacity-Aware and Delay-Guaranteed Resilient Controller Placement for Software-Defined WANs
    Tanha, Maryam
    Sajjadi, Dawood
    Ruby, Rukhsana
    Pan, Jianping
    I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2018, 15 (03): : 991 - 1005
  • [33] Enhanced capacitated next controller placement in software-defined network with modified capacity constraint
    Papasani, Aravind
    Varma, G. P. Saradhi
    Reddy, P. V. G. D. Prasad
    Yannam, V. Ramanjaneyulu
    INTERNATIONAL JOURNAL OF COMMUNICATION SYSTEMS, 2024,
  • [34] A LOAD-BALANCED ALGORITHM FOR MULTI-CONTROLLER PLACEMENT IN SOFTWARE-DEFINED NETWORK
    Wang, Qing
    Gao, Lirong
    Yang, Yaotong
    Zhao, Jianjun
    Dou, Tongdong
    Fang, Haoyu
    MECHATRONIC SYSTEMS AND CONTROL, 2018, 46 (02): : 72 - 81
  • [35] Dynamic and static controller placement in Software-Defined Satellite Networking
    Wu, Shuai
    Chen, Xiaoqian
    Yang, Lei
    Fan, Chengguang
    Zhao, Yong
    ACTA ASTRONAUTICA, 2018, 152 : 49 - 58
  • [36] Robust Controller Placement and Assignment in Software-defined Cellular Networks
    Abdel-Rahman, Mohammad J.
    Mazied, EmadelDin A.
    Teague, Kory
    MacKenzie, Allen B.
    Midkiff, Scott F.
    2017 26TH IN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ATION AND NETWORKS (ICCCN 2017), 2017,
  • [37] On Reliability-optimized Controller Placement for Software-Defined Networks
    Hu Yannan
    Wang Wendong
    Gong Xiangyang
    Que Xirong
    Cheng Shiduan
    CHINA COMMUNICATIONS, 2014, 11 (02) : 38 - 54
  • [38] Learning the Optimal Controller Placement in Mobile Software-Defined Networks
    Koutsopoulos, Iordanis
    2022 IEEE 23RD INTERNATIONAL SYMPOSIUM ON A WORLD OF WIRELESS, MOBILE AND MULTIMEDIA NETWORKS (WOWMOM 2022), 2022, : 70 - 79
  • [39] Controller robust placement with dynamic traffic in software-defined networking
    Zhang, Zhen
    Lu, Jie
    Chen, Hongchang
    COMPUTER COMMUNICATIONS, 2022, 194 : 458 - 467
  • [40] A new model for the controller placement problem in software-defined networks
    Wu, Di
    Tang, Bi-hua
    Yuan, Dong-ming
    Hu, He-fei
    Ran, Jing
    WIRELESS COMMUNICATION AND SENSOR NETWORK, 2016, : 486 - 493